John Johnson discusses converting urban industrial buildings into AI data centers and the challenges of the current market.

Patmos CEO John Johnson has never raised outside capital. His model: convert urban industrial buildings into AI data centers in 90 days. The company turned a 400,000 sq ft Kansas City printing press into a live training facility for Nebius and secured a $100M PACE loan to finance it.
